Maintain and approve accurate employee records and transactions in the Workday HCM system including new hires, job changes, leaves, and payroll data.
Conduct weekly payroll reconciliation by reviewing audit reports, analyzing discrepancies, and processing corrections to ensure accurate payroll feeds.
Support various HR processes such as benefits enrollment, leave management, recognition award processing, employee reimbursements, and generate reports requiring precise HR data.
Bachelor's degree or equivalent qualification in HR.
Minimum 1 year of experience working with HRIS/HCM systems.
Proficiency in MS Excel with ability to manipulate data and learn business systems.
Work Experience Required: At least 1 year in HRIS/HCM related roles.
Experience with Workday HCM system and HR Shared Services delivery model.
Ability to work effectively in fast-paced, multi-cultural, and multi-country environments.
Strong detail orientation with a focus on data accuracy and quality in transactional HR processes.
